Tipos de memoria RAM

RAM

Se denomina memoria a los circuitos que permiten almacenar y recuperar la información. En un sentido más amplio, puede referirse también a sistemas externos de almacenamiento, como las unidades de disco o de cinta. Memoria de acceso aleatorio o RAM (Random Access Memory) es la memoria basada en semiconductores que puede ser leída y escrita por el microprocesador u otros dispositivos de hardware. El acceso a las posiciones de almacenamiento se puede realizar en cualquier orden.

Características de la memoria principal (RAM)

Un sistema de memoria se puede clasificar en función de muy diversas características. Entre ellas podemos destacar las siguientes: localización de la memoria, capacidad, método de acceso y velocidad de acceso. En el caso de la memoria RAM (también denominada memoria principal o primaria) se puede realizar la siguiente clasificación:

Localización: Interna (se encuentra en la placa base)

Capacidad: Hoy en día no es raro encontrar ordenadores PC equipados con 64, 128 ó 256 Mb de memoria RAM.

Método de acceso: La RAM es una memoria de acceso aleatorio. Esto significa que una palabra o byte se puede encontrar de forma directa, sin tener en cuenta los bytes almacenados antes o después de dicha palabra (al contrario que las memorias en cinta, que requieren de un acceso secuencial). Además, la RAM permite el acceso para lectura y escritura de información.

Velocidad de acceso: Actualmente se pueden encontrar sistemas de memoria RAM capaces de realizar transferencias a frecuencias del orden de los Gbps (gigabits por segundo). También es importante anotar que la RAM es una memoria volátil, es decir, requiere de alimentación eléctrica para mantener la información. En otras palabras, la RAM pierde toda la información al desconectar el ordenador.

Según los tipos de conectores que lleve la memoria, al conjunto de éstos se les denominan módulos, y éstos a su vez se dividen en:

SIMM (Single In-line Memory Module): Pequeña placa de circuito impreso con varios chips de memoria integrados. Se fabrican con diferentes velocidades de acceso capacidades (4, 8, 16, 32, 64 Mb) y son de 30 ó 72 contactos. Se montan por pares generalmente.

DIMM: Son más alargados, cuentan con 168 contactos y llevan dos muescas para facilitar su correcta colocación. Pueden montarse de 1 en 1.

Los principales tipos de memoria RAM utilizadas en nuestros ordenadores se dividen en DRAM, SRAM y Tag RAM

Tipos de memoria DRAM

FPM (Fast Page Mode): Memoria muy popular, ya que era la que se incluía en los antiguos 386, 486 y primeros Pentium. Alcanza velocidades de hasta 60 ns. Se encuentra en los SIMM de 30 contactos y los posteriores de 72.

EDO (Extended Data Output): La memoria EDO, a diferencia de la FPM que sólo podía acceder a un solo byte al tiempo, permite mover un bloque completo de memoria a la memoria caché del sistema, mejorando así las prestaciones globales. De mayor calidad, alcanza velocidades de hasta 45 ns. Se encuentra en los Pentium, Pentium Pro y primeros Pentium II en SIMM de 72 contactos y en los primeros DIMM de 168 contactos, funcionando a 5 y 3,3 voltios.

BEDO (Burst Extended Data Output): Diseñada originalmente para los chipset HX, permite transferir datos al procesador en cada ciclo de reloj, aunque no de forma continuada, sino a ráfagas, reduciendo los tiempos de espera del procesador, aunque sin conseguir eliminarlos del todo.

SDRAM (Synchronous DRAM): Memoria asíncrona que se sincroniza con la velocidad del procesador, pudiendo obtener información en cada ciclo de reloj, evitando así los estados de espera que se producían antes. La SDRAM es capaz de soportar las velocidades del bus a 100 y 133 MHz, alcanzando velocidades por debajo de 10 ns. Se encuentra en la práctica mayoría de los módulos DIMM de 168 contactos.

PC-100 DRAM: Es un tipo de memoria SDRAM que cumple unas estrictas normas referentes a calidad de los chips y diseño de los circuitos impresos establecidas por Intel. El objetivo es garantizar un funcionamiento estable en la memoria RAM a velocidades de bus de 100 MHz.

PC-133 DRAM: Muy parecida a la anterior y de grandes exigencias técnicas para garantizar que el módulo de memoria que la cumpla funcione correctamente a las nuevas velocidades de bus de 133 MHz que se han incorporado a los últimos Pentium III.

DRDRAM (Direct Rambus DRAM): Es un tipo de memoria de 64 bits que alcanza ráfagas de 2 ns, picos de varios Gbytes/sg y funcionan a velocidades de hasta 800 MHz. Es el complemento ideal para las tarjetas gráficas AGP, evitando los cuellos de botella entre la tarjeta gráfica y la memoria principal durante el acceso directo a memoria para el manejo de las texturas gráficas.

DDR SDRAM (Double Data Rate SDRAM o SDRAM II): Un tipo de memoria SDRAM mejorada que podía alcanzar velocidades de hasta 200 MHz. Cuenta con mecanismos para duplicar las prestaciones obtenidas a la velocidad del reloj del sistema. Fue soportada por ciertos chipset Socket 7, pero al no ser apoyada por Intel no está demasiado extendida.

ESDRAM (Enhanced SDRAM): Incluye una pequeña memoria estática en el interior del chip SDRAM. Con ello, las peticiones de ciertos accesos pueden ser resueltas por esta rápida memoria, aumentando las prestaciones. Se basa en un principio muy similar al de la memoria caché utilizada en los procesadores.

SLDRAM (SyncLink DRAM): Se basa, al igual que la DRDRAM, en un protocolo propietario, que separa las líneas CAS, RAS y de datos. Los tiempos de acceso no dependen de la sincronización de múltiples líneas, por lo que este tipo de memoria promete velocidades superiores a los 800 MHz, ya que además puede operar al doble de velocidad del reloj del sistema.

Memoria SRAM

Es la abreviatura de Static Random Access Memory y es la alternativa a la DRAM. No precisa de tanta electricidad como la anterior para su refresco y movimiento de las direcciones de memoria, por lo que funciona más rápida, aunque tiene un elevado precio. Hay de tres tipos:

Async SRAM: La memoria caché de los antiguos 386, 486 y primeros Pentium, asíncrona y con velocidades entre 20 y 12 ns.

Sync SRAM: Es la generación siguiente, capaz de sincronizarse con el procesador y con una velocidad entre 12 y 8,5 ns.

Pipelined SRAM: Se sincroniza también con el procesador, pero tarda en cargar los datos más que la anterior, aunque una vez cargados accede a ellos con más rapidez. Opera a velocidades entre 8 y 4,5 ns.

Memoria Tag RAM

este tipo de memoria almacena las direcciones de memoria de cada uno de los datos de la DRAM almacenados en la memoria caché del sistema. Así, si el procesador requiere un dato y encuentra su dirección en la Tag RAM, va a buscarlo inmediatamente a la caché, lo que agiliza el proceso.


Memoria RAM

Comentarios

Entradas populares de este blog

Parches oficiales de PES2010

Cerveceria Centro Americana, S.A.

Historia de las Lectoras y de los Discos